Time-Delay Inline Fuses

Able to withstand current overload for a short time, these fuses will not open when exposed to harmless temporary surges. They are designed to handle high inrush loads from ballast transformers in fluorescent lighting systems. You'll need both a fuse and a fuse holder (not included) to add an inline fuse to an existing circuit. Fuses have a built-in cap that securely connects to the fuse holder. Also known as LMF fuses.
Breakthrough current, labeled on the fuse as IR, is the maximum current that a fuse can safely stop in the event of a short circuit.
